Job Description
Location: Louisville, KY Salary: $45.00 USD Hourly - $53.00 USD Hourly Description: The Senior Quality Engineer is responsible for driving product and process excellence across manufacturing and engineering operations. This role ensures that quality standards are met through rigorous data analysis, proactive issue resolution, and cross-functional collaboration. You will lead quality investigations, manage corrective actions, strengthen quality systems, and support continuous improvement initiatives that enhance operational performance and product reliability. Key Responsibilities Quality Analytics & Continuous Improvement Analyze quality metrics and trends to develop data-driven insights that support continuous improvement initiatives. Lead structured problem-solving activities, including Root Cause and Corrective Action (RCCA), 5-Whys, and countermeasure development. Support tiered management and structured escalation processes to ensure timely visibility and resolution of critical issues. Operational Quality Support Partner closely with operators and manufacturing teams to communicate, confirm, and reinforce quality requirements. Conduct Measurement System Analysis (MSA) to verify measurement capability, accuracy, and repeatability. Lead containment efforts for quality issues to minimize production impact and ensure safe product release. Facilitate and participate in preliminary reviews for Non-Conformance Reports (NCRs). Systems, Audits & Documentation Support development and maintenance of inspection plans, control plans, and quality assurance procedures. Perform internal process audits and respond to Corrective Action Requests (CARs). Review technical documents and contractual quality requirements to ensure compliance with engineering standards. Contribute to counterfeit part control processes and help define appropriate risk mitigation methods. Advanced Quality Engineering Lead or support Process Failure Mode and Effects Analysis (PFMEA) activities to identify and mitigate risks. Apply Geometric Dimensioning & Tolerancing (GD&T) principles to verify design intent and manufacturability. Manage work packages and support Basis of Estimate (BOE) creation to accurately define project scope. Champion ROI-driven quality improvements that elevate product integrity and operational efficiency. Required Qualifications Bachelor's degree in Engineering, Quality, or a related technical field; or 10+ years of relevant professional experience in lieu of a degree. Minimum 5 years of experience in quality engineering within manufacturing, aerospace, defense, or similarly regulated industries.
